Mine are deep litter kept in large hoop houses. Lots of space per bird. 10 hens and a rooster in a 14x16 hoop house. They have been free ranging daylight until dark until now. Now I've got lots of garden space that can get to so until after harvest they have a run by day and a large spacious hoop house by night. In bad weather they can stay inside.

We do have to feed and water them all daily. Under two hours a day for that.
